Pramanta is a charming village located in the mountainous region of Epirus, Greece. Situated at an altitude of approximately 1,100 meters, it offers breathtaking views of the surrounding natural landscapes. Known for its untouched beauty, Pramanta attracts nature enthusiasts, hikers, and photography enthusiasts.
The village is nestled in the heart of the Tzoumerka mountain range, which provides a tranquil and serene atmosphere for visitors. Pramanta is home to lush forests, dense vegetation, and crystal clear rivers. The area is perfect for exploring on foot, with numerous hiking trails that lead to hidden waterfalls, traditional stone bridges, and stunning viewpoints.
Pramanta is also known for its traditional architecture, characterized by stone-built houses and narrow cobblestone streets. Walking through the village, visitors can admire the local craftsmanship, as well as visit charming local cafes, taverns, and bakeries that showcase the region's culinary delights.
